Flying Cat Penguin

ゆるゆる仕事、ソフトウェアテスティング関連のことについて綴ります。

AtCoder 修行日記#60

60日目
ABCのC問題に取り組み中。

勉強用のコンテンツはここから。
https://kenkoooo.com/atcoder/#/table/

進捗と一言感想

[C問題] 2問(残り148問)

ABC012:九九足し算

特になし。

n = int(input())
 
sum = 0
for i in range(9):
  for j in range(9):
    sum += (i+1) * (j+1)
 
number = sum - n
answers = []
for i in range(9):
  for j in range(9):
    if number == (i+1) * (j+1):
      answers.append([(i+1),(j+1)])
 
for answer in answers:
  print(answer[0],"x",answer[1])
ABC176:Step

特になし。

n = int(input())
an = [int(num) for num in input().split()]
 
sum = 0
for i in range(len(an)-1):
  if an[i] > an[i+1]:
    sum += an[i] - an[i+1]
    an[i+1] += an[i] - an[i+1]
    
print(sum)
目標
  • まず、今年中に茶色コーダー
学習方針

以上。